Valuer Acumentis predicts rise in distressed sales

Michael Bleby

Forced home sales will increase as the federal government's JobKeeper support payment and bank mortgage repayment holidays come to an end and home owners unable to keep up repayments have to sell their dwellings, valuation firm Acumentis says.

ASX-listed Acumentis, which in December changed its name from LandMark White after a challenging 2019, this week said it was benefiting from a pick-up in residential activity.
